WebSep 7, 2024 · git reset and git revert are both useful commands for undoing changes that have been made in previous commits. While git reset does this by moving the current head of the branch back to the specified commit, thereby changing the commit history, git revert does this by creating a new commit that undoes the changes in the specified commit and …

WebFor this reason, git revert should be used to undo changes on a public branch, and git reset should be reserved for undoing changes on a private branch.
